Frosinone vs Juventus: TV channel, live stream, squad news & preview

Juventus have won all four of their Serie A games so far, though their season has already been blighted after Cristiano Ronaldo was given a red card during his side's Champions League clash with Valencia earlier in the week.

The loss of the Portuguese superstar will be a huge blow for the Italian side, who are desperate to taste European glory, particularly as it was Ronaldo's experience in winning the competition that led them to spend such a hefty sum of cash on him.

The Serie A champions will travel to 19th-placed Frosinone on Sunday, in a game Ronaldo will be expected to feature prominently.

Douglas Costa has been banned from playing Juventus' next four Serie A matches, but also picked up ankle and thigh knocks during the European tie against Valencia, which could leave him sidelined for up to four weeks. Midfielder Sami Khedira also picked up an injury in Spain and will not feature.

Ronaldo and Paulo Dybala flank Mario Mandzukic in attack, while Juan Cuadrado is deployed as a right-back for the Bianconeri.

Match Preview


Cristiano Ronaldo Valencia Juventus Champions LeagueGetty Images

Frosinone have lost three of their opening Serie A games so far, drawing the other, which is good news for Juventus and Ronaldo, should the Portuguese international want to bounce back from the devastation of his red card against Valencia.

Ronaldo finally got off the mark last weekend as he opened his goalscoring account against Sassuolo, scoring two goals, and he is expected to make another solid contribution to the side when they travel to Frosinone – who are in the relegation zone.

The red card that the 33-year-old received will not rule him out of a return to former club Manchester United in the Champions League group stage, much to his and the Bianconeri's relief.

Midfielder Costa was given a four-match ban for violent conduct and spitting on a Sassuolo player in the previous game, though will see out his ban from the medical table after picking up an injury in Spain.
